Cal State LA Downtown – Medical Billing and Coding Program
Local Training Program
California State University, Los Angeles operates a specialized Medical Billing and Coding Program through its Downtown LA Center, providing an intensive 80-hour test preparatory program accessible to Arcadia students. The program focuses on practical billing and coding skills essential for healthcare professionals, including CPT and ICD-10 manual proficiency, insurance claim filing, and claims appeal procedures. This comprehensive training prepares Arcadia-area students for professional certification exams including the AAPC Certified Professional Coder (CPC) and AHIMA Certified Coding Associate (CCA) credentials.
- Program Type: Certificate
- Data Source: Google Search – Local Program
- Format: On-campus/Online hybrid
- Program Duration: 80 hours (approximately 4-6 weeks)

Medical Records Specialist Salary and Employment Data
According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) May 2023 data, medical records specialists and health information technicians in the Southern California region earn the following wages:
- 10th Percentile (Entry-level): $28,840 annually
- 25th Percentile: $33,920 annually
- Median Annual Wage: $42,630
- 75th Percentile: $52,180 annually
- 90th Percentile (Experienced): $64,220 annually
Arcadia graduates with professional certifications (CPC, CCA, CBCS) typically earn higher salaries than non-certified professionals, with certified coders earning average salaries 15-25% above entry-level positions. Career advancement to supervisor, manager, or compliance officer positions offers additional earning potential for experienced Arcadia medical billing professionals.

What’s the difference between medical billing and medical coding?
Medical coding and medical billing serve complementary but distinct roles in Arcadia healthcare settings. Medical coders translate patient diagnoses, procedures, and services into standardized codes (CPT, ICD-10, HCPCS) using clinical documentation. Medical billers use those codes to create insurance claims and manage payment collection from insurance companies. Both roles require specialized training and certification, and many Arcadia professionals develop expertise in both areas. Some programs provide comprehensive training covering both billing and coding responsibilities.

What medical billing and coding certification should I pursue after completing an Arcadia program?
The best certification for Arcadia professionals depends on career goals and employer preferences. The AAPC Certified Professional Coder (CPC) credential is most widely recognized for general coding positions in Arcadia healthcare settings. AHIMA credentials (CCA, CCS, RHIT) are preferred for health information management and hospital positions. Arcadia students should research employer certification preferences in their target healthcare settings before enrolling in training programs. Many Arcadia programs provide preparation for multiple certification exams, allowing graduates to choose the credential that best aligns with their career objectives.
